Adventure Tips

Stay Hydrated Throughout the Day

Bring plenty of water, especially during summer, to stay hydrated while paddling under the sun.

Wear Layered Clothing

Temperatures can vary greatly; dress in layers to stay comfortable from morning chill to midday warmth.

Protect Yourself from the Sun

Use sunscreen, sunglasses, and a hat to guard against strong UV rays reflecting off the water.

Familiarize Yourself with Basic SUP Techniques

If new to stand-up paddleboarding, review balance and paddling techniques before the trip for a smoother experience.

Local Insights

Wildlife

  • River otters
  • Golden eagles

History

The Ruby Horsethief Canyon area holds significance as a historic route once used by indigenous tribes and early settlers along the Colorado River.

Conservation

Grand Junction SUP promotes low-impact paddling practices to protect the fragile river ecosystem and maintain water quality.
